An independent Federal Reserve has long been the cornerstone of U.S. economic stability, but what happens when that foundation is shaken?
In this week’s episode of Bits + Bips, the panel digs into one of the most dramatic threats yet to financial markets: Donald Trump’s suggestion that he could fire Fed Chair Jerome Powell. It’s not just political theater, it’s a potential major blow to the credibility of the U.S. dollar and the independence of the world’s most important central bank.
Joining the panel is Zach Pandl, Head of Research at Grayscale, who explores why a rotation away from U.S. dollar assets might already be happening and what that means for bitcoin.
Plus:
Why the Fed’s independence is so crucial
The telltale signs of a structural capital rotation out of the U.S.
Whether bitcoin has officially decoupled from equities
How young crypto HODLers will react to their first bear market
